The telencephalon is the endbrain part. It comprises some structures like the basal ganglia, the cerebral cortex, the olfactory system, and others. The cerebral cortex structure in the endbrain support higher-level processes like emotion, consciousness, thought, language, emotion, memory, and language. The olfactory system is the brain structure that is responsible for a sense of smell.
The functions of each of the five divisions of the brain
Myelencephalon
Myelencephalon division is involved in numerous roles that are fundamental to survival, such as initiating sleep, respiratory rhythm, motor activity, and wakefulness (Nieuwenhuys et al.,2007).
